    1. Mindfulness Meditation: Cultivating Inner Peace

    Mindfulness meditation has gained widespread recognition for its ability to reduce pain perception and improve overall well-being. By focusing on the present moment without judgment, individuals can develop a greater sense of acceptance and resilience in the face of pain. 

    Incorporating mindfulness meditation into your daily routine can help alleviate stress, which is often a contributing factor to increased pain levels.

    2. Gentle Exercise: Nurturing the Body

    Engaging in gentle exercise, such as yoga, tai chi, or swimming, can provide significant relief for chronic pain sufferers. These low-impact activities promote flexibility, strength, and relaxation, while also releasing endorphins – the body’s natural painkillers. 

    Start with activities that suit your fitness level and gradually increase intensity as your pain allows. Remember, consistency is key, so aim for regular exercise sessions to reap the full benefits.

    3. Heat and Cold Therapy: Soothing Discomfort

    Heat and cold therapy are simple yet effective techniques for managing pain and inflammation. Applying a heating pad or warm towel to the affected area can help relax tense muscles and improve blood flow, easing discomfort. 

    Conversely, cold packs or ice packs can numb the area, reduce swelling, and alleviate acute pain. Experiment with both heat and cold therapy to discover which works best for your specific needs.

    4. Herbal Remedies: Harnessing Nature’s Healing Power

    Several herbal remedies have shown promise in relieving various types of pain. For example, turmeric contains curcumin, a compound with potent anti-inflammatory properties that can reduce pain and stiffness associated with conditions like arthritis.

    5.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Changing Thought Patterns

    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is a therapeutic approach that focuses on identifying and changing negative thought patterns and behaviors. By challenging unhelpful beliefs about pain and developing coping strategies, individuals can significantly reduce their pain levels and improve their quality of life. 

    CBT can also help individuals develop skills to manage stress, anxiety, and depression, which often accompany chronic pain conditions.

    6. Acupuncture: Balancing Energy Flow

    Originating from traditional Chinese medicine, acupuncture involves inserting thin needles into specific points on the body to rebalance energy flow and alleviate pain. While the mechanism of action is not fully understood, many people report significant pain relief and improved function following acupuncture sessions. 

    Consider exploring acupuncture as part of your holistic pain management plan, but be sure to seek treatment from a licensed and experienced practitioner.

    8. Support Networks: Finding Strength in Community

    Living with chronic pain can feel isolating, but you’re not alone. Building a support network of friends, family members, and healthcare professionals can provide invaluable emotional support and practical assistance. 

    Joining support groups or online communities for individuals with chronic pain can also offer a sense of belonging and empowerment, as you connect with others who understand your struggles and triumphs.
